About This Item

New York: Warner, 1992. First Edition. Hardcover. Near Fine/Near Fine. Near Fine in a Near Fine jacket, unclipped ($14.95), bumped at the head of the spine, a strip of fading down the rear spine fold. Green paper on the spine with light brown paper on the boards. Square and firmly bound, former owner's bookplate on the front endpaper. Waller's classic Midwestern love story between a National Geographic photographer and an Italian bride living in southern Iowa. Famously adapted into the 1995 Clint Eastwood film starring Eastwood and Meryl Streep.

Synopsis

The Bridges of Madison County is a 1992 best-selling novel by Robert James Waller which tells the story of a married but lonely Italian woman, living in 1960s Madison County, Iowa, who engages in an affair with a National Geographic photographer from Bellingham, Washington who is visiting Madison County in order to create a photographic essay on the covered bridges in the area. The novel is presented as a novelization of a true story, but it is in fact entirely fiction.
